This print titled "The Wisemen of the East" transports us back in time to the biblical era, capturing a significant moment from The Bible Picture Book published by Thomas Nelson around 1950. Painted by Robert Hope, this color lithograph showcases a scene filled with godly reverence and historical significance. In this image, we witness the three wise men adorned in majestic costumes as they journey towards Bethlehem to pay homage to the newborn King. Their presence symbolizes faith, wisdom, and devotion as they follow the guiding star that leads them to their destination. The setting takes place in a humble stable where Mary and Joseph cradle baby Jesus. This pivotal event marks the birth of Christianity's central figure and holds immense religious importance for believers worldwide. Matthew's gospel narrates how these wisemen brought precious gifts of gold, frankincense, and myrrh as offerings for the divine child.
